AOM - Vote Today DAPHNE, Ala. – Athletes representing eight countries make up the United States Sports Academy’s July Athlete of the Month ballot, which is online now for voting at the Academy’s website, https://ussa.edu/aom/aom-ballot/.

Voting will continue until 5 p.m. Central time on Thursday, 18 August 2022.

Male nominees are Mondo Duplantis, athletics, Sweden; Aaron Judge, baseball, United States; Victor Kiplangat, marathon, Uganda; Noah Lyles, athletics, United States; Michael Norman, athletics, United States; and Cameron Smith, golf, Australia.

Female nominees are Tobi Amusan, athletics, Nigeria; Brooke Henderson, golf, Canada; Sydney McLaughlin, athletics, United States; Felicia Stancil, BMX, United States; Annemiek van Vleuten, cycling, the Netherlands; and Johana Viveros Mondragon, inline speed skating, Colombia.

Each month, the public is invited to participate in the Academy’s worldwide Athlete of the Month program by nominating athletes and then voting online during the first week of every month. The online votes are used to guide the Academy selection committee in choosing the male and female monthly winners, who then become eligible for selection to the prestigious Athlete of the Year ballot. A worldwide public vote on the annual ballot is used to guide the committee in making the final selection.
